

The score is divided into three section in which 3 smaller patterns lie becoming a guide for the composition of the audio itself – the outer ring possesses the shape of the numerical phrase 545, the middle ring 165 and inner most ring 786. Using this – I bring a visual element to piece as a whole, allowing me to create an environment within the space. Concentric rings, which are used to visually represent these numerical phrases, provide the piece an additional layer of structure and composition. Each ring contributes to the overall visual design by encapsulating a specific portion of the audio.
The use of concentric circles visually emphasises the connection between the numerical patterns and the accompanying audio portions by implying a sense of harmony, integration and unity overall. This combination bridges the gap between abstract visual representation and a more tangible auditory perception. The visual acts as a guide for myself as well as a means of communicating the structure and intention of the music to the audience.
